Let's say I have a Product field with values A, B, C, D, E. I want to display a text box when A or B or both A & B are in the selection criteria. So basically pass when:
Product NOT IN('A','B')
What is the syntax I need to use in QV to do this? I've tried things like this, but I can only get it to work if I have one or the other selected. When I select both, then the text box shows up.
-- Product <> 'A' and Product <> 'B' and Product <> ('B' and 'A')
-- NOT(Product = 'A' or Product = 'B')
(and I worded that first part badly... I want the text box to show when A or B is not selected.)
Hi, try this:
=sum(aggr(if(match(Field, 'A','B'),1,0),Field)) = 0
Regards.
Yep, that did the trick! It shows the box if I pick just A, just B, or A&B.
